Response to inquiries to the US Embassy in Freetown regarding the opening of an office by the FBI.

August 9, 2005

Freetown
Tel: 226481

The FBI is considering establishment of a regional Legal Attaché Office at the US Embassy in Freetown to supplement the work of its Legal Attaché Offices in Lagos and Dakar.  These offices are not "top secret" as alleged by some media.  Budget appropriation legislation passed by the United States Congress for 2005, a public document, requires the FBI to open an additional office in West Africa, preferably in Freetown or Monrovia.  A Legal Attaché Office liaises with local law enforcement authorities, investigates U.S. crimes, and offers law enforcement training to local police.
